    North American distribution boards are generally housed in enclosures, with the positioned in two columns operable from the front. Some panelboards are provided with a door covering the breaker switch handles, but all are constructed with a dead front; that is to say the front of the enclosure (whether it has a door or not) prevents the operator of the circuit breakers from contacting live electrical parts within. carry the current from incoming line (hot) conductors to the breakers.

  • Functional Principle of Cable Trays in Power Distribution Rooms

    Functional Principle of Cable Trays in Power Distribution Rooms

    Cable trays allow for maximum air circulation around the conductors, facilitating heat dissipation and preventing the buildup of heat that can degrade cable insulation and reduce the current-carrying capacity, or ampacity, of the wires. A cable tray system is a structured assembly used to support and organize insulated electrical cables for power distribution, communication, and control signals.
